Transaction eb4f537ab1aef814c887f8628089a0e63f0ca048d67872029f53a25f5799314e
1 Input
1 Output
-
eb4f537ab1aef814c887f8628089a0e63f0ca048d67872029f53a25f5799314e:0
- value
- 637472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7c887e00a39801595490e3f2e62053793c2a04d OP_EQUAL
- address
- 3MMyRufskxjb3QqtxffsDvrBb6JqMwyrH6